The Sacrifice Scooters at Skates.co.uk are perfect for your sporty child who likes a bit of speed in their life. The OG Hustler sets a new benchmark in affordable performance scooters. With a threadless headset and ICS compression, it's a serious ride that will stay dialled for miles. It comes with a triple concave deck that is 115mm wide x 500mm long with an 82.5 degree HT angle. The hustler bars are 550mm wide and 600mm high and are made from high strength steel and come gripped with trusty S-Grips. It also comes with a set of sweet 10mm split forked 5 spoke aluminium core wheels, 2 bolt clamp, super sport flex fender brake and camo design grip tape.
